About This Novel
In Lin Chaoxi's eyes, she had known Chen Xun for twelve years, from the age of twelve to twenty-four. At the age of twelve, she was timid and cowardly, with low self-esteem and dared not introduce herself. At the age of twenty-four, he is reflected in every line of her writing. But in fact, their lives have nothing to do with each other! The good impression I had when I was young has not faded away with time, but it has become an obsession that I dare not even think about and cannot forget. In Chen Xun's eyes, he had a smooth journey from childhood to adulthood without any troubles. The only time he felt regretful was when he was twenty-four years old, he met a girl, but he didn't hug her tightly the first time. He only vaguely remembered that the girl was very good at the age of seventeen. Later, their life trajectories intertwined with each other, and he always regretted not saying to the twelve-year-old her: "Hello, my name is Chen Xun!" Chasing a dazzling person is a very overestimating thing. When you were seventeen, you couldn't catch up because of his brilliance, and when you were twenty-four, you shrank because of his brilliance. Maybe I won't see you again for the rest of my life, but I'm still glad I met you when I was young! [It should be a short short film, not very long, about secret love, reunion after separation, and dreams come true]
